在使用某些软件或游戏的过程中,用户可能会遇到“找不到ij15.dll”或“ij15.dll已损坏”的错误提示。这类错误通常表明系统缺少必要的动态链接库(DLL)文件或者该文件已经损坏。本文将探讨导致ij15.dll文件缺失的常见原因,并提供几种有效的解决方法。
原因分析
-
文件丢失:
ij15.dll文件可能由于安装过程中的错误、意外删除或不当卸载程序而丢失。一些安全软件可能会误判并删除被认为是威胁的文件。 -
文件损坏:
病毒或恶意软件感染可能导致ij15.dll文件损坏。系统崩溃或异常关机也可能引起文件损坏。不正确的文件移动或重命名操作也可能是原因之一。 -
版本不兼容:
如果ij15.dll文件的版本与当前使用的软件或操作系统版本不匹配,可能导致错误发生。软件更新后没有相应更新依赖的DLL文件,也会造成此类问题。 -
软件安装不完整:
在安装相关软件时如果安装程序未正确完成,可能导致某些必需的文件未能被正确部署到系统中。
解决方法
方法一:重新安装或修复相关软件
- 卸载出现问题的软件。
- 访问官方网站下载最新版本的软件安装包。
- 重新安装软件,并确保按照指示完整安装所有组件。
方法二:手动下载并放置ij15.dll文件
- 从可信来源下载正确的ij15.dll文件。
- 将下载的文件复制到系统的
System32
目录(对于64位Windows系统,还需要复制到SysWOW64
目录)。 - 打开命令提示符(以管理员身份),输入
regsvr32 ij15.dll
来注册新的DLL文件。 - 使用杀毒软件检查新下载的文件是否安全。
方法三:使用系统文件检查器(SFC)
- 打开命令提示符(以管理员身份)。
- 输入
SFC /scannow
命令并回车。 - 等待扫描和修复过程完成。这可以帮助恢复丢失或损坏的系统文件。
方法四:更新Microsoft Visual C++ Redistributable
- ij15.dll通常是Microsoft Visual C++ Redistributable的一部分。
- 访问微软官网下载最新的Visual C++ Redistributable包。
- 安装对应于您的操作系统位数(32位或64位)的版本。
方法五:执行全面的安全扫描
- 使用可靠的防病毒软件进行全面系统扫描。
- 清除任何检测到的病毒或恶意软件。
- 重启计算机后再次尝试运行软件。
方法六:更新驱动程序
- 检查并更新所有相关的硬件驱动程序,尤其是显卡驱动。
- 访问制造商网站下载最新版本的驱动程序。
专业修复工具
如果以上方法都不能解决问题,您可以考虑使用第三方系统修复工具,如DirectX修复工具等软件,它们能自动检测并修复缺失或损坏的DLL文件。
DLL报错-全方位扫描修复-DirectX修复工具https://dll.sly99.cn/download/DirectX_c7_t19374609.exe
步骤1:下载DirectX修复工具
首先,我们需要下载DirectX修复工具,打开工具点击一键扫描,或根据实际情况点击修复。
步骤2:扫描系统错误
接下来,你需要让DirectX修复工具扫描你的系统错误。这个工具会自动检测你系统中所有的错误,并列出来。你需要的只是等待一会儿。
步骤3:修复错误
然后你需要点击“立即修复”按钮。此时,DirectX修复工具就会自动下载并安装相关文件。这个过程可能需要一些时间,具体时间取决于你的网络速度。